PBEEE Scholarship in Canada | How to Apply 2024

The goal of the PBEEE Scholarship is to draw exceptional researchers and students from outside to Quebec, Canada. International students who want to start or continue their studies or research projects at universities in Quebec, Canada, can apply for annual grants of up to $35,000.

The PBEEE Scholarship programs for 2024 are intended for international students who intend to pursue or continue their studies or research activities in Québec and who currently possess a work permit or study visa.

Applications have to be filed in accordance with a faculty member at ÉTS suggestion. The recommendations must be received between June and July of 2024, at the latest.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• neither possess Canadian citizenship nor maintain a permanent residence there.
  • Must not have submitted an application for permanent residency under Canadian immigration legislation; a supervisor or professor recommendation is required.
  • must be submitting an application to start a graduate program at one of the participating colleges.

Host Country: Canada

Eligible Countries: All Countries

Benefits:

  • Master’s: $20,000 annually for a two-year maximum.
  • Doctorate: $25,000 annually for up to three years.
  • Professional development or short-term research project: $3,000 per month, up to a maximum of four months.

Deadline: July 1, 2024
